Output 1ecb0abc0c30b4fc15e3f3782f712863e0061794a07c2ac3ea70cf65d39143ee:24

value
3766
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ae15e02d529d1ce1c74a23e9194e2390d922b85e05353b2a5debbde7ad496393
address
bc1p4c27qt2jn5wwr362y053jn3rjrvj9wz7q56nk2jaaw770t2fvwfsvy4660
transaction
1ecb0abc0c30b4fc15e3f3782f712863e0061794a07c2ac3ea70cf65d39143ee
spent
true